在现代计算环境中,Linux系统因其开放源代码和高度的可定制性而备受青睐。越来越多的用户选择Linux,不仅因为其安全性,还因为其能够为开发者和技术爱好者提供无穷的探索空间。尽管许多用户在使用Windows或macOS时积累了丰富的经验,但在Linux中安装软件仍对一些人来说是个难题。本文将详细介绍在Linux中安装常用软件的一些基本步骤,帮助用户轻松上手。

要在Linux中安装软件,通常有几种主要的方式可供选择:
1. 使用包管理器:Linux的发行版大多数都带有自己的包管理器,负责软件的安装、升级和卸载。比如,在基于Debian的系统(如Ubuntu)中,可以使用`apt`命令;而在基于Red Hat的系统中,则使用`yum`或`dnf`。通过包管理器,用户可以方便地在终端运行如下命令进行软件安装:
- Debian/Ubuntu:`sudo apt install 软件名字`
- Red Hat/Fedora:`sudo dnf install 软件名字`
这种方法不仅简单明了,还能自动处理依赖关系。
2. 使用图形界面的软件中心:对于不熟悉命令行操作的用户,可以依赖图形用户界面(GUI)软件中心进行软件安装。大多数Linux发行版都会预装类似Ubuntu Software、GNOME Software等工具,只需搜索所需软件并点击安装即可。这种方式更为直观,适合初学者。
3. 从源码编译:对于一些特殊的软件或需要从最新源代码构建的版本,用户可以选择下载源码进行编译。这个过程通常会涉及到安装编译工具和必要的依赖,具体步骤大致如下:
- 下载源码包。
- 解压缩文件。
- 进入解压后的目录,执行`./configure`、`make`、`make install`等命令。
这种方式能够提供更大的灵活性,但需要一定的技术背景和了解对应的依赖关系。
4. 使用容器技术:如Docker与Snap等容器技术也为软件安装提供了新的方式。通过这些工具,可以在不影响系统其他部分的情况下,运行不同版本或不同配置的软件。对开发者或需要多环境支持的用户,这提供了额外的便利。
5. 下载二进制文件:有些软件提供了预编译好的二进制文件,用户只需要下载并按照说明文档进行安装就可以了。这种方式在一些特定场景下非常实用,特别是对于不依赖于系统包管理器的应用。
安装完软件后,定期更新软件也是非常重要的。在Linux中,利用包管理器可以简单地执行更新命令,如:
- Debian/Ubuntu:`sudo apt update && sudo apt upgrade`
- Red Hat/Fedora:`sudo dnf update`
这样可以确保系统和软件都是最新版本,享受到最新的功能和修复的安全漏洞。
这样一来,Linux软件的安装过程就变得轻松多了。不论是日常办公、开发环境还是娱乐需求,只要掌握基本的方法,就能在Linux系统中畅快地使用各种软件。
常见问题解答(FAQ)
1. 在Linux中安装软件最简单的方法是什么?
使用包管理器是最简单的方式,大多数情况下只需输入几行命令即可。
2. 是否可以使用Windows软件在Linux上?
可以通过Wine等兼容层或虚拟机来运行Windows软件,但并不保证所有软件都能顺利运行。
3. 如何查找Linux中软件的安装包?
可以在终端中使用`apt search 软件名字`或`dnf search 软件名字`来查找。
4. 编码编译时遇到问题该怎么办?
检查依赖包是否已安装,且仔细阅读文档中的错误提示,大多数问题都能通过安装必要的库解决。
5. 如何卸载已经安装的软件?
使用包管理器的卸载命令,像`sudo apt remove 软件名字`或`sudo dnf remove 软件名字`即可。